Abstract
A structure that tan reduce abrupt-bend losses in dielectric optical waveguides
is proposed. The structure has a relatively low refractive-index region at the
outside of the corner; the region operates as a phase-front accelerator of the
propagating mode. It has been ascertained by basic experiments that the bending
loss of this structure can be significantly reduced from that of the
conventional one.
